Once the saccharine cacophony of the holiday season gets to be too much, as it inevitably will, consider celebrating in a different mode. To mark the reissue of 1999's Christmas EP — which contains what is surely the least invigorating arrangement of "Little Drummer Boy" ever recorded — the Duluth, Minn., trio Low is taking its brand of elegantly mournful almost-rock on a weeklong West Coast tour. In addition to threadbare renditions of holiday standards, expect selections from a catalog that spans more than 15 years, from the funereal lilt of the band's mid-'90s output through the menacing thump of the late '00s — plus probably a preview or two from Low's ninth album, C'mon, to be released next year on Sub Pop.
